<str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Council</strong> (SCC) Recognizes Global <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Leaders<br />
<str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Council</strong> (www.supply-chain.org) is a global management organization that maintains the supply<br />
chain world’s most widely accepted framework for evaluating and comparing supply chain activities and<br />
performance: the <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Operations Reference (SCOR ® ) model. The SCC <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Excellence</strong> <strong>Awards</strong><br />
encourage the continuous advancement of the supply chain management body of knowledge and the sharing of<br />
that knowledge between organizations.<br />
Worldwide Industry And Market Recognition<br />
<str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Council</strong> actively promotes and profiles the superior performance and management practices of the<br />
winning organizations. SCC recognizes executive representatives from the regional winners at SCC events held<br />
within each region. The Global <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Excellence</strong> award winners are revealed in a gala ceremony at the<br />
annual SCC Global User Meeting.<br />

The 3 award categories:<br />
<br />
<br />
Operational <strong>Excellence</strong><br />
The <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Operational <strong>Excellence</strong><br />
award recognizes an organization that operates<br />
significant components of a supply chain and<br />
has demonstrated excellence in the design,<br />
operation, or improvement of that supply<br />
chain. Commercial, nonprofit, and government<br />
organizations are eligible for this award.<br />
Academic Advancement<br />
The <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Academic <strong>Excellence</strong> award<br />
recognizes an organization that contributes<br />
significant research that advances the supply<br />
chain management body of knowledge. This<br />
award focuses on applied research.<br />
<br />
Technology Advancement<br />
The <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Technology Advancement<br />
award recognizes the organization that<br />
develops a methodology or product that<br />
enables superior performance in supply<br />
chain operations. Software developers and<br />
consultants are encouraged to participate with<br />
practitioner organizations to provide a realworld<br />
example for evaluating the value of their<br />
advancements.<br />

Special Regional <strong>Awards</strong><br />
Some regions present special supply chain excellence awards specific to that region only. For example, the North<br />
American region presents the U.S. Department of Defense Award for <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Operational <strong>Excellence</strong>. This award<br />
recognizes an organization within or serving the U.S. Department of Defense that has demonstrated excellence in supply<br />
chain design, operation, or improvement.<br />

All Organizations Are Eligible<br />
The <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Operational <strong>Excellence</strong> <strong>Awards</strong> are open to all organizations (SCC members and<br />
nonmembers) that have made significant improvements in their supply chain performance. This includes<br />
manufacturers, retailers, distributors, service providers, and third-party logistics providers. We encourage<br />
applications based on specific supply chain improvement initiatives and projects.<br />
The <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Academic Advancement <strong>Awards</strong> are open to all organizations performing research in<br />
the area of supply chain operations or supply chain management.<br />
The <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Technology Advancement <strong>Awards</strong> are open to all companies that provide technology<br />
solutions demonstrating significant and proven improvements in supply chain performance for users. These<br />
include hardware vendors, software vendors, systems integrators, and consultants.<br />
Nonprofit academic and research organizations that win the regional awards also receive a $1,000<br />
scholarship donation to support their efforts to educate the next generation of supply chain leaders. The<br />
global award winner receives a $3,000 scholarship.<br />
Each organization may submit up to two entries per location. Consultancies can only enter the Operational<br />
<strong>Excellence</strong> and Technology Advancement award categories in partnership with a client. The client will be<br />
the designated entrant and the consultancy will be listed (on all publications and presentations) as a partner<br />
organization.<br />

SCC Global <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Excellence</strong> <strong>Awards</strong><br />
The three operational, academic, and technology award winners from each of the four regions compete for the<br />
Global <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> Operational <strong>Excellence</strong> Award in each category. SCC judges then select an overall Global<br />
<strong>Excellence</strong> Award winner from the regional category winners and the special regional award winners. They present<br />
the Global Award for <str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Excellence</strong> to the organization that has made the greatest contribution to<br />
advancing the supply chain management body of knowledge or practice within the past year.<br />
The Application Process<br />
Review detailed submission guidelines and download the award applications<br />
for your region on the SCC website: supply-chain.org/enter-awards. The<br />
application material for each region requests basic information that includes:<br />
Business overview<br />
A brief description of the business unit or organization. This overview should<br />
include the organization’s mission and objectives, products and services<br />
offered, markets where it competes, and key operational challenges.<br />
Challenge<br />
The supply chain issue or problem that the organization recognized,<br />
addressed, and solved. This could be a supply chain optimization or<br />
reorganization project, a strategic initiative, a merger, a technology<br />
implementation, a major product launch, or risk mitigation.<br />
Solution<br />
The specific steps and process that supply chain managers followed to<br />
address the challenge.<br />
Outcome<br />
The results in terms of measureable benefits to the organization, to<br />
customers, and to the achievement of the targeted objectives.<br />

Judging Process Overview<br />
A panel of expert members in each region will review all entries. The chairs of the regional judges form the judging<br />
panel for the global awards.<br />
Detailed judging criteria are available on the SCC website (supply-chain.org/enter-awards). In general, the SCC<br />
<strong>Supply</strong> <strong>Chain</strong> <strong>Excellence</strong> Award winners are selected based on:<br />
the nature, breadth, and the complexity of the project undertaken;<br />
the results of the project in terms of supply chain performance improvement and financial benefits; and<br />
the ability to characterize the project and effectively communicate its significance.<br />
